First officer’s supplemental. It has been two weeks since Captain Masters left on a mission leaving me in command of the Swiftfire. I never knew that the Captain had so much work to do! This is not as easy as I thought. The paper work in particular is tedious and boring, how does Jonathan do it? It has also been a few weeks since we joined Task Force 59, the very same group we helped a few months ago in hunting down a Jem’Hadar super carrier. But our time at the front was short-lived. It was more of a rallying point then anything else. We have since fallen back to a sector close to the Federation border with the Breen where we are on pirate hunting duties. We are basing ourselves at the Ashcroft Outpost and we are tasked with convoy protection and patrols. This also means we have a special guest onboard the ship…
Commander Susan Core paused as the door chime sounded. “Computer, end log,” she ordered. She waited for the affirmative beep from the computer before she answered the door. “Come in.” The door opened and in stepped a man in black civilian clothing. “Mr. Patol, what can I do for you?” Core asked. It was Brendan Patol, the Swiftfire’s special guest. The man was a totally unremarkable looking man. He had no distinguishing features and looked like any forty something human in the quadrant. He was of average height and build, Caucasian male. He wouldn’t look out of place in a Starfleet uniform, diplomatic uniform, or as a carpet retailer. But there was something special about him; he was a specialist in pirates and para-military groups. He had been part of the Maquis in their battle against the Cardassians, but other then that Susan didn’t know much about him. His history was incomplete, but by the fact he wasn’t in a Starfleet prison and seemed to live a pretty good life she suspected that he was either working with Starfleet Intelligence or had made a very good deal with Starfleet following the fall of the Maquis. “We received a report of another attack,” said Patol. “Who?” “The Rough Necks, they hit a convoy not too far from here.” Patol handed her a padd. She read the contents and cringed. The Rough Necks were one of the largest and powerful pirate groups in several sectors. They had been causing a lot of problems since the war started due to the fact that Starfleet’s ships were tied up in combat or defensive duties in other sectors. This was the group they were had been tasked with bringing down. “When?” “Around 0300 ship time. They took munition, equipment and supplies that were meant for Outpost Clarity, a major deep space research station in the sector.” “Causalities?” “Two escorts destroyed, one crippled. The attack didn’t match their profile. They’ve avoided hitting convoys with similar sized escorts. Plus the items they stole don’t fetch that much on the black market.” “They’re onto us.” Patol nodded. “I agree. It is a bit hard to hide thirty Starfleet starships suddenly entering the area. I had hoped they wouldn’t have noticed us so soon though, they must have a good surveillance system worked out. It will be harder to find and predict them now.” “So what do you suggest?” “We keep to our original plan for now. We can’t protect every convoy, sooner or later they’ll make a mistake and we’ll get them.” |
